rattle in driver's side window
 
Would be very interested in any fixes known for an annoying, recurring drivers side window/upper door frame rattle in my 2008 ES 350, occurs when going over bumps, uneven roads, or sometimes with just normal driving. Intermittent, but very common. Have had dealer address this and they replaced the "glass run" on that side, but rattle returned within a few days. Will try some silicon spray to dampen it, but seems like there is some flaw when the window is full up to door frame that produces this ticking rattle- can eliminate it by lowering the window an inch so that it does not insert into door frame. Any help would be appreciated.

I had exact same problem when I bought my car new. The dealer wasn't able to fix it (they opened the door panel, seatbelt retractor with no result) and it was driving me crazy for a whole month. Then I read in IS forum somebody had the same problem and dealer was able to fix it by adjusting the door latch. So I took my car back with printed copy of the thread and asked them to look into it. Next day they fixed it. I think yours is exactly what I experienced. You may want ask your dealer to look into this if nothing else works.

I have not yet checked with dealer about door latch as possible cause- have "dealer fatigue" trying to get them to fix this without ever really nailing it. But, have muted it quite well doing the following: buy a roll of velcro peel back self stick tape, ~1/2 inch thick. Place this across entire inner panel where driver's window goes up into outer door frame. Will need about 2.5 feet of this stuff to cover it, and make sure it covers almost all of the black plastic across full window diameter. This seems to have eliminated rattle for now, since must be poor apposition of window to door frame, and when materials contract in cold, it rattles. When lower window, you'll see the velcro, but its black and blends in quite well with black plastic.

This is common in Sienna's and the usual fix is to add a washer or 2 to the lower left bolt for the window mechanism. Apparently, the window lift arms may rub when the window is fully up and the washer allows more space. You can test by seeing if the rattle is gone when the window is lowered a couple of inches and driving over the same road area.
Others have fixed it with velcro etc as described above.
Most Toyota/Lexus vehicles use a very similar window lift design.
